Postgraduate Diploma in HR and Talent Management (PGDipTM)

Programme Overview | Admission & Fees | Application | Downloads & Enquiry

SHRI’s PGDipTM programme will equip learners with processes and toolkits on how to connect organisational excellence to people management by systematically identifying, keeping, developing and promoting the organisation's best people. Learning resources will include simple, efficient, easy-to-follow methods for assessing, planning, and developing high-value people to meet your organisation’s current and future needs. It will help you combine your organisation’s diverse human resources activities into an integrated system.

The programme will benefit HR and non-HR practitioners including those with direct or related responsibilities for driving the talent agenda in their organisation.

Upon successful completion of this programme, graduates shall be able to:

  • Understand the potential of integrating your company's infrastructure of HR assessment, planning, and development tools.

  • Explain how to align your company's people with the current and future needs of the organisation by placing employees in positions that maximize their value.

  • Identify and develop highly qualified backups for key positions, which are critical to organisational continuity

  • Allocate resources to employees based on actual and/or potential contribution to organisational excellence

  • Explain how to build all your HR disciplines on the "building blocks" of organisational competencies, performance appraisal, and forecast of employee/manager potential.

  • Determine how to enhance employee performance through coaching, mentoring, constructive dialogue, and feedback.

  • Describe powerful reward systems that support different talent management strategies.

  • Articulate how to create a talent management system to significantly improve your organisation's return on its HR investment.

Course Content

Module 1 - Human Resource Management - 36 Hours
This module gives an overview of the key functions of the human resource department including a segment dedicated to International Human Resource Management.

  • Human Resource Management Functions

  • Human Resources Strategies, Policies and Procedures

  • Job and Competency Analysis

  • Performance Management

  • Human Resource Planning

  • Recruitment and Selection

  • International HRM

Module 2 - Human Resource Development - 36 Hours
This module provides learners with knowledge and skills for human resource development functions. Through a project/assignment, learners will develop and acquire the necessary skills and expertise. The module includes an overview of People Developer programme.

  • The Training Process and Theories

  • Approaches and Techniques to Training Needs Analysis

  • Set Training Objectives and Design Training Programmes

  • Planning and Resource Requirements

  • Implementing and Monitoring Training Programme

  • Evaluation of Training Effectiveness

  • The People Developer Programme and Future Trends in HRD

Module 3 - Strategic & Change Management - 36 Hours
This module explores and evaluates the concepts and theories of "Strategic & Change Management" and develops learners’ cognitive processes integral to strategic management. Special emphasis is given to the approach of human resource functions towards total operations.

  • Strategic Management Process: An Overview

  • The 3 Strategy-making Tasks

  • Industry and Competitive Analysis

  • Company Situation Analysis

  • Strategy and Competitive Advantage

  • Matching Strategy to Company's Situation

  • Diversification Strategy and Analysis

  • HR Dimension in Corporate Strategic Management

  • Change Management

Module 4 - Talent Management: The Key to Organisational Sustainability - 30 Hours(Processes, Practices, Tools and Activities)
This intellectually-rewarding module is based on applied research and contemporary practices. It has a strong applications-based format depicting the Processes, Practices, Tools and Activities for corporate planners, Human Resource Managers and Talent Management Executives who need to serve as Internal Consultants or Change Catalysts, tasked to provide a talent solution that will unleash the maximum potential of human creativity and productivity to meet the new business challenges their organisations are facing.

  • The basics of Talent Management

  • Talent Management Processes and Activities

  • External and Internal Drivers impacting on Talent Management

  • Talent Management and Organisational sustainability

  • Talent Alignment and Development

  • Measuring and Monitoring Talent Management Effectiveness

  • Rewarding and Recognising Talent

  • Trends and Leading Practices in Talent Management

Module 5 - Talent Management: Effective Implementation of Talent Management Programmes - 30 Hours
This module will help learners to design talent retention programmes and activities that boost employee engagement and performance, as well as create and sustain business excellence in your organisation.

  • Overview of talent management programmes

  • Assessing strengths and weaknesses in retention strategies

  • Employee Engagement and Retention

  • Training and developing your talent pool

  • Manager's role in developing talent and improving retention

  • Coaching & Mentoring Talent for Results

  • Leadership Development and Succession Management

  • Evaluate new talent programme and measure the return on investment

The modules listed above may be conducted in a different sequence.

Click here for detailed course content >>

Course Duration

  • 5 months; 168 training hours

  • 5 modules

  • Lessons are conducted on Friday evening (7pm to 10pm) and/or weekend (full day; 10am to 6:30pm)

Assessment Methods
Candidates are assessed by assignments and written examinations at the end of each module except for Strategic & Change Management module whereby assessment is based on Group and Individual Assignments.

Postgraduate Diploma in HR and Talent Management will be awarded by SHRI upon successful completion of the programme and graduates may use the title "PGDipTM" after their names.

Advancement
PGDipTM graduates holding a bachelor degree are encouraged to enroll in the Master of Human Resources programme, jointly offered by Curtin University of Technology and SHRI, subject to acceptance by the University.
